A feminine noun is almost always used with feminine articles and adjectives (e.g., la mujer bonita, la luna llena).
feminine noun
a. wake
El hombre lloró la muerte de su esposa durante la velación.The man mourned his wife's death during the wake.
a. covering with a veil
Se realizó la ceremonia de la velación tras la boda.The covering with a veil took place after the wedding.
